Instrument hygiene, though oft overlooked, is certainly a relevant topic. You not only want your instrument looking its best, but you want to protect your investment.
We advocate minimal polish but regular wiping with a quality cloth. Gently rubbing the skin oil and dust that has accumulated during practice (let alone performing) ought to be as routine as brushing your teeth.
